Emotional eating is more than just a bad habit; it’s a compulsion that can be downright unhealthy for your physical and emotional health.

If it seems like your strongest food cravings come when you’re at your lowest emotional point, you are an emotional eater.  You may feel good – temporarily – by digging into the raw cookie dough.  But, in the end, you’re going to feel even worse.  Whether it’s feelings of guilt over ruining your diet, feelings of shame over the lack of control you have, or feelings of insecurity over the extra pounds you’ve gained – emotional eating is destructive.
